BERESNAK, Fernando. Being and time and its Sociopolitical and Scientific Worldview Environment. Andamios [online]. 2020, vol.17, n.44, pp.179-202.  Epub Sep 27, 2021. ISSN 2594-1917.  https://doi.org/10.29092/uacm.v17i44.796.

The objective of this article is to contextualize analytically and critically the emergence of Martin Heidegger’s work, Being and Time. The peculiarity of the task in question will be that this contextualization, far from being constructed from exogenous data of this work, will be carried out from the analytical and critical considerations that Heidegger made explicit or allowed to glimpse in that text. Through this approach, not only is it intended to show what happened around the epoch of the author in question, but also how his knowledge of the social, political and scientific problematics of his time contributed to the selection of his object of study and the issues to treat its proper treatment.

Keywords : Heidegger; worldview; science; sociopolitical; subjectivity.
